Ep 26: From cost center to value creator: how product thinking transforms IT ft. Rajendran Dandapani

In this episode of Server Room, we sit down with Rajendran Dandapani, Director of Engineering at Zoho Corp. and President of Zoho Schools of Learning, to explore how product thinking can transform the role of IT from a cost centre to a strategic driver of growth. We discuss what “product thinking” really means for IT teams, how to turn infrastructure, support, and operations into sources of competitive advantage and why tomorrow’s IT leaders need cross-disciplinary skills beyond technology.

Episode 25: The dark side of GenAI: deepfakes, data and the future of trust ft. Malini Christina Raj

Generative AI is changing the way we work, create, and even trust what we see online. In this episode of Server Room, we sit down with Malini Christina Raj, Head of LATAM AI Research at Zoho Corp, to unpack the realities behind GenAI. From building models and the math that powers them, to data curation, privacy, AI agents, reinforcement learning, and the growing threat of deepfakes, we cover it all.
